Billie Eilish’s existential song “What I Was Born For” Barbie single, which won the Academy Award for Best Original Song. The win marks the second Oscar win for Eilish and her brother and co-writer Finneas O’Connell, who also won in 2022 for their unforgettable Bond theme song “No Time to Die.”

Eilish and O’Connell have been honored for their work throughout awards season Barbie, won the Golden Globe and Grammy Awards for Song of the Year and Best Song for Visual Media. The pair also performed “What Was I Made For” earlier in the show, featuring orchestra and band. Barbie Pink background.
Other nominees for best original song this year include “Wahzazhe (Song for My People)” Killers of the Flower Moon“It never goes away” American Symphony Orchestraand “The Fire Within” fiery as fireand another hit song, “I’m Just Ken.” Barbie‘s soundtrack, which Ryan Gosling performed earlier in the night.
